Possible case of Ebola in Lanaudi?re
MONTREAL GAZETTE
Published on: January 20, 2015
Last Updated: January 20, 2015 5:34 PM EST
Quebec?s ministry of Health and Social Services has announced that a patient in the Lanaudi?re region has undergone tests for the Ebola virus.
The patient, who has not been identified, recently returned from one of the West African countries impacted by the deadly virus and began exhibiting possible symptoms.
The results of the tests are now pending, the ministry said. Five other potential cases were recorded in Quebec in recent months. All of them ended up being false alarms.
